Josiah Liu

Student

I am studying for a B.S. in Computer Science in the Department of Information and Computer Sciences at the University of Hawaii. I expect to graduate in Spring, 2025.


Interests: Software Engineering, Programming, Fitness, Games, Surfing


Projects

My first practice WOD! 2023-8-30

My first practice WOD for ICS 314.

Javascript ICS 314 Practice WOD

Read More
Campus Concert 2023-12

I worked in a group projet from ICS 314 which we created a website for musicisians to find other people's interest and future concerts!

Group Project JavaScript Meteor GitHub Software Engineering

Read More
ILWU Food Drive 2020

My team and I helped during the food drive for ILWU during Covid-19.

Volunteer Life Scholarship ILWU

Read More
PWH Beach Cleanup 2019-8-17

Me and my team volunteer for a beach cleanup.

Volunteer Scholarship Beach

Read More

Essays

Experience Software Engineer With Me

13 Dec 2023

The Adventure of Software Engineering ! Taking this class it was a great experience and made me realize there is much more than just coding. I’ve most definitely learned a lot from this class and this course challenged me mentally...

Software Engineering Learning Reflection

Design Patterns in Software Engineering

30 Nov 2023

My perspective on Design Patterns ! Design Patterns are basically a way of making code very neat and fixing them with the appropriate purpose. Sometimes it’s not the way you like it but it can be very helpful. The way...

Software Engineering Learning Design Pattern

AI at it's Finest!

21 Nov 2023

Introduction When it comes to the use of AI (Artificial Intelligence), many people think that it’s cheating or a way of being lazy to do it on your own. Before I came into ICS 314, I’ve never used AI and...

Software Engineering Learning AI

The Beauty of UI Frameworks

04 Oct 2023

UI Frameworks Bootstrap 5 is probably one of the most useful frameworks in HTML but sometimes it can be frustrating. Using Bootstrap 5 is definitely a go to when making websites to make it look appealing and attractive which kind...

Software Engineering Learning HTML CSS Bootstrap 5

Listen to ESLint

21 Sep 2023

Coding Standards : Errors For one week using ESLint, I always get confused and a bit scared noticing that all of my code shows an error all the time. I tend not to get frustrated and realize that my code...

Software Engineering Learning JavaScript ESLint

The Smart Way To Ask Questions

07 Sep 2023

Overview In software engineering, asking questions is one of the most important things when it comes to communicating with your fellow members whenever you’re working on a project, solution and other things. Smart questions are always valid and important in...

StackOverflow Learning

See all 8 essays